我有一个单选按钮,它根据交易类型的值设置True或False的值可以找到演示here问题是当我点击任何单选按钮时,$scope.transaction.debit的值没有改变我的javascript代码是varapp=angular.module('myApp',[]);app.controller("MainCtrl",function($scope){$scope.transaction={};$scope.transaction.debit=undefined;console.log('controllerinitialized');});请让我知道我做错了什么。此外,我不想为此
这个问题在这里已经有了答案:Settingandgettingbootstrapradiobuttoninsideangularrepeatloop(1个回答)关闭9年前。我在Angular的ui.bootstrap中为radio模型动态生成选项时遇到问题。我想我可以简单地ng-repeat一个数组,使用它的btn-radio属性的内容,如下所示://inthecontroller$scope.radioModel=undefined;$scope.radioModelButtons=["a","b","c"];//inthehtml{{value}}我使用的是angular1.1.4
我找到了这个JavaScript小部件http://wicky.nillia.ms/headroom.js/我想在使用Bootstrap3的Web应用程序中使用它。它似乎不起作用。有什么建议或例子我应该做什么?我目前在导航栏上使用navbar-fixed-top。我尝试过使用和不使用它,但它仍然无法正常工作。我可以看到应用于页眉的headroom.js类,但对UI元素没有影响。已解决你需要添加这个样式。.headroom{position:fixed;top:0;left:0;right:0;transition:all.2sease-in-out;}.headroom--unpinn
我正在使用bootstrap-datepicker在我的网站上。日期选择器将用于定义搜索过滤器。我需要datepicker输入元素的初始值为空,所以不会引入搜索结果的日期过滤器。当用户点击链接到日期选择器的文本输入时,日期选择器弹出框应该选择下个月的第一天。问题:如果我要设置初始日期(如下所示),文本输入将填充今天的日期,这不是我想要的。但是,如果我不设置初始日期,日期选择器将显示1970年代。我该怎么办?类似于:jQueryUIDatepicker的演示JS代码varnow=newDate();varnextMonth=newDate();nextMonth.setDate(1);n
使用悬停触发器可以正常显示弹出窗口。通过click触发器显示弹出窗口效果很好。现在,当鼠标悬停在触发图像上时,如何让弹出框出现,但如果用户单击图像,取消悬停并启动点击切换?换句话说,悬停显示弹出窗口并单击“固定”弹出窗口。HTML非常标准:User还有popover初始化,更无聊:$(function(){$("[rel=popover]").popover();});据我目前所见,解决方案似乎是一组很好的复杂的popover('show')、popover('hide')和popover('toggle')调用,但我的javascript/jQuery-foo不能胜任这项任务。编辑:
这个问题在这里已经有了答案:HideAngularUIBootstrappopoverwhenclickingoutsideofit(12个答案)关闭7年前。我试图在点击弹出窗口外的任何地方时关闭我的Angular-bootstrappopover。根据对这个问题的回答,现在可以通过使用新的popover-is-open属性来完成(在版本0.13.4中):HideAngularUIBootstrappopoverwhenclickingoutsideofit目前我的HTML看起来像这样:...和我相关的Controller代码:vm.togglePopover=false;vm.ope
我正在使用AngularUI-Bootstrap实现提前输入。我需要显示根据来自数据库的某些值分组的结果。这是一个示例场景数据库中有一些用户,每个用户都有一个“部门”。一个用户名可以在多个部门使用。最终用户键入姓名以从数据库中搜索用户,并在预输入列表中检索列表。由于一个用户名可以属于多个部门,所以需求是显示不同部门分组的用户名。像这样:然后用户可以选择所需的用户名并继续。根据Typeahead文档提供here,我看不到任何选项可以满足我的要求。我已经尝试了这个解决方法:每当typeahead数组形成时,我将用户部门附加到数组元素:$scope.fetchUsers=function(v
我正在尝试使用一个简单的switch语句,但它无法编译。这是代码:tag=0switchtagwhen0thenalert"0"when1thenalert"1"coffeescript编译器在switch语句之后的行中提示“unexpectedthen”。我将代码更改为:switchtagwhen0thenalert"0"when1thenalert"1"而且效果很好。但是我需要在switch语句的then部分的多行上使用多个语句。这不可能吗? 最佳答案 只需完全删除then即可。仅当您不想拥有新的缩进block时才需要它。tag
在手机上,导航栏上有一个下拉菜单。但它太慢了。它是基于JQuery的吗?还是基于CSS过渡?如何加快速度? 最佳答案 它是基于CSS过渡的,尝试从此类的过渡属性更改高度值。.collapsing{position:relative;height:0;overflow:hidden;-webkit-transition:height.35sease;-o-transition:height.35sease;transition:height.35sease;} 关于javascript-如
是否可以在javascript中使用嵌套的switch语句。我的代码是这样的switch(id1){case1:switch(id2){case1:{switch(id3){case1:{}case2:{}}}case2:{switch(id4){case1:{}case2:{}}}}case2:}如果是,那么这是一个很好的做法,或者我们可以使用任何替代方法。 最佳答案 你的方法绝对没问题。您可以使用switch(true)使switch的嵌套不那么复杂:switch(true){case((id1===1)&&(id2===1)&